The overview below groups typical Circular Window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Memphis, TN.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Fixing or replacing a single circular window typically costs between $250 and $600. Many routine repairs fall within this range, depending on window size and complexity.

Standard Installation - Full installation of a new circular window usually ranges from $1,000 to $3,000 for most homes in Memphis. Most projects land in this middle tier, with fewer reaching the higher end for custom or larger windows.

Full Replacement - Replacing multiple or larger circular windows can cost $3,500 to $7,000 or more. Larger, more complex projects tend to push into this higher price range, especially if structural modifications are needed.

Custom or Specialty Projects - Unique or custom circular window installations, including specialty glass or intricate framing, can exceed $7,000. These projects are less common and typically involve higher material and labor costs.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are circular windows typically used for? Circular windows are often chosen to add architectural interest, bring in natural light, or serve as decorative accents in various rooms such as bathrooms, stairwells, or entryways.

Can existing windows be replaced with circular ones? Yes, experienced contractors can replace existing windows with custom circular windows, ensuring proper fit and installation to match the building’s structure.

What materials are commonly used for circular window installations? Circular windows can be made from materials like vinyl, wood, aluminum, or fiberglass, depending on the style preferences and durability needs of the property.

Are circular windows suitable for all types of buildings? Circular windows are versatile and can complement many architectural styles, but it’s best to consult with local contractors to determine if they suit specific building designs.

How do local service providers handle circular window installation projects? Local contractors assess the space, provide custom solutions, and handle the installation process to ensure the window is securely and properly fitted into the existing structure.
